Output 68df22dec1966a0e3a79c0d4f9b94d06972b373fbad93922fd407991e5592915:1

value
15316986
script pubkey
OP_HASH160 OP_PUSHBYTES_20 c870b9b95ef34e4845e55175d808135b9b8adeed OP_EQUAL
address
MSAzR6mYSAqgS4g24GTKntb8RjqqvraReH
transaction
68df22dec1966a0e3a79c0d4f9b94d06972b373fbad93922fd407991e5592915
spent
true